Workshop Tools Explained: Types and Purposes

Knowing about machining tools is critical for anyone involved in fabrication . These implements remove material from a object to form a desired design. There's a broad selection of cutting tools accessible , some suited for certain jobs. Popular varieties include:

  • Face mills: Utilized for subtracting material quickly in a whirling way.
  • Drills: Form cylindrical openings .
  • Taps & Dies: Utilized for creating screw threads in metal .
  • Blades: Used for severing material to dimension.

The option of machining tool depends on aspects like the substance being machined , the needed finish , and the present machinery . Accurate choice ensures optimal output and prolongs the tool's lifespan .

Machining Tool Mount Types: A Detailed Overview

Selecting the right turning tool holder is essential for gaining best output and improving tool duration in your lathe. There are multiple types available, some built for certain applications. Standard options feature square holders, round supports, hydraulic mounts, and quick-change holders, every offering different benefits regarding stability, adjustability, and convenience of use. Familiarizing yourself with these variations is necessary for making smart decisions.

The Future of Cutting Tools Design and Materials

The evolving landscape of manufacturing demands a substantial shift in cutting tool creation and materials. We're observing a progression towards 3D manufacturing website methods, allowing for increasingly sophisticated geometries and internal heat channels that enhance performance and durability. In addition, research into novel materials, such as nanomaterials and metal matrix composites, provides exceptional hardness and erosion resistance. Expect incorporated sensor systems to deliver real-time data on tool condition, enabling predictive maintenance and improving machining operations. Ultimately, the future holds tools that are both advanced and more capable.
